New York: Vaccinated Visitors Allowed to Join in the Times Square NYE Celebrations

According to latest official statements, vaccinated visitors can celebrate the famed New Year’s Eve ball drop tradition at Times Square this year. However, proof of covid-19 vaccination is mandatory to join in the event.




The announcement was made by New York City Mayor Bill de Blasio who said,

We want to welcome those hundreds of thousands of folks, but everyone needs to be vaccinated. All you need to do is have proof of vaccination and valid photo ID and you are in.

Last year the event was held virtually due to pandemic concerns.


Preparations for New Year’s Eve celebrations at Towns Square are underway to make the event as safe as possible. Tom Harris, Head of the Times Square Alliance took part in the press conference to celebrate the return of the world-famous New Year’s celebration. Al visitors above the age of five must show proof of vaccination and those without must have a negative PCR test conducted within 72 hours. Unvaccinated people must be wearing masks at all times during the event.
